This patch adds general polish to the game. The next patch will add the multilingual system, which will support 29 languages!

  • If an upgraded bones ally becomes a rabbit, his head would turn into a black box and his torso wouldn't change into a bunny. This is now fixed.

  • Unlimited arrows quiver ragdoll drew as a black box. This is now fixed.

  • In the info tutorial message for unlimited quiver, the quiver image was still the placeholder image.

  • Quiver is now lined up correctly for ragdoll

  • During a recent patch, the cape stopped drawing for Herakles' ragdoll. This is now fixed and the cape draws for his ragdoll.

  • Fixed a bug where music and sound would fade in/out too quickly. Steps were provided into a function I made but milliseconds was needed. So it would fade in/out 16x faster than I had intended. It was almost like no fade was happening at all. I now have more control over the fade amount. I mostly have it set to a simple 1 second fade out and 1 second fade in. Better than an abrupt transition but still very subtle.

  • Added 2 new music tracks, by Adam Mullen, to the game. One additional level track, as well as a boss track for the campaign.

  • Added a "Random Level Playlist" checkbox to the Audio tab in Settings. This will randomize the 5 level tracks in the game. This won't change when the main menu music plays (on main menu and credits) or when the new boss track plays (campaign boss level). The previous method was that all level tracks played in a traditional order.

  • Added a fun little shotgun kickback variable that can be changed via console commands. The command can be accessed by typing 'variables' into the console.
